1.2.0 • Published 1 year ago

@golms/prettier-config v1.2.0

Weekly downloads
-
License
MIT
Repository
github
Last release
1 year ago

prettier-config

Prettier config used at SimonGolms

npm version License: Apache-2.0 Maintenance Conventional Commits semantic-release: angular

Usage

Install the package using npm

npm install --save-dev --save-exact @golms/prettier-config

Create a .prettierrc.js file in your projects root directory and export your desired modifications.

module.exports = {
  ...require("@golms/prettier-config"),
  // printWidth: 140, // to overwrite the property
};

Check out the prettier documentation for more info on sharing configurations.

Local Development

Install Dependencies

npm install

Test

npm test

Repair

This command may be useful when obscure errors or issues are encountered. It removes and recreates dependencies of your project.

npm run repair

Release

Fully automated version management and package publishing via semantic-release. It bumps the version according to conventional commits, publishes the package to npm and release a new version to GitHub.

Automatic Release (GitHub Action) Recommended

Make sure that the secrets GITHUB_TOKEN and NPM_TOKEN are available in GitHub repository.

npm run release:ci

Manual Release

Make sure that the environment variables GITHUB_TOKEN and NPM_TOKEN are set or declared in .env and a productive build was previously created via npm run build.

npm run release

Show your support

Give a ⭐️ if this project helped you!

License

Copyright © 2022 Simon Golms. This project is MIT licensed.

Resources